All Categories
Featured
Table of Contents
The Leetcode platform is made use of for the on-line coding round. We permit you to pick a programs language you are most comfortable with during the coding obstacle. We also make use of Google Jamboard for the design round. All the rounds are carried out online. Our meeting process at Opn is straightforward, and we guarantee you are well-prepared for the technical rounds.
The technical interview includes two rounds: (a) the coding round and (b) the style round, each lasting one hour. You will certainly have 50 mins to react to inquiries and 10 mins for Q&A. Depending upon the availability of both the prospect and the job interviewer, these rounds might happen on different days.
Possibly, it has been a very long time given that you last touched them, so take enough time to go back to practice. Recognize the principles, study the syntax very thoroughly, and obtain aware of various methods of replying to the concerns. During the meeting, prior to trying to create your solution, you might want to first clarify the question with the job interviewer, assess the issue, and information the reasoning and why you will certainly pick this strategy to solving the issue.
It is very important to explain that the interviewers desire you to do well and are there to sustain you. Rationale for you is to show the recruiter just how you think, communicate, and whether you can resolve troubles. By doing so, you have actually opened the floor to engage much more with the recruiter and welcome any recommendations connected with dealing with the coding problems.
Still, it is common among our recruiters to ask questions around the topic of payment entrances as this will certainly be most relevant to your daily job. In the layout round, prospects are urged to give their suitable software application architecture style to implement a theoretical service under certain restrictions. Questions can include: Layout a repayment system for a shopping system.
Design an e-commerce vendor acquisition and customer platform system. Layout a system that allows each user to send messages or images. When being spoken with and during coding rounds, it's valuable to repeat the questions to the recruiter to guarantee that both of you get on the very same web page. If you do not understand, do not hesitate to ask the recruiter to repeat or rephrase the concern.
I've been a full desk technical employer for virtually 10 years. Most of my time has been invested as a company employer with Code Ability, yet I also have a year of internal recruiting experience on Twitter's Revenue System group.
I want to flag that the guidance given is based upon my individual point of views and experience, and must not be thought about an endorsement of the employing processes utilized in huge technology, or by firms mimicing huge tech hiring. Instead, it is planned to supply support on just how to browse the "sector standard" meeting procedure and enhance your chances of success.
In all severity, you can inform a whole lot regarding your positioning to a firm and their worths based on this page. Furthermore, sites like Glassdoor and Blind can supply useful understandings into the firm's meeting procedure, worker experiences, and wages. It's additionally an excellent concept to investigate your recruiter and their function to get a better understanding of their perspective and what they might be trying to find in a candidate.
Exactly how has the meeting procedure been until now? Often our impulses are effective devices that are disregarded; it's vital to resolve any kind of reservations regarding the duty or business prior to waging the process. Self-reflect throughout the whole procedure and do it usually! Do you have an advisor? There are numerous factors why it is necessary to have a fantastic coach, however in this situation, it's perfect for method.
Treat every method as an interview; it might also assist with those game day nerves! In the 'Understanding is Power' area, I stated the importance of identifying company values.
Furthermore, the Celebrity approach will certainly assist you develop answers to potential behavioral interview inquiries. Behavior meeting inquiries are frequently taken straight from these job description bullet factors.
How? By showing excellent partnership abilities, explaining their thought procedures, and most significantly, their mistakes. If you can express your f-ups and "could-have-beens" well, you might just obtain the job. Commonly, it's even more about your technique and your capacity to be a great colleague than your service. Throughout the technological meeting, maintain these concerns in mind: Have you collected your demands? Do you recognize what you're doing? Are you checking in with your interviewer? They exist to work together with you.
Ask for a moment. It's okay to take a break. Being sincere and susceptible (when secure) can help you stand out from other prospects.
Bear in mind, you're freaking remarkable, and your distinct qualities and experiences can aid you land your desire task so long as it's the appropriate fit for you.'s a list of companies that do not white boards or adhere to "typical tech" meeting procedures, phew.
Do look into all these questions with answers from listed below: Software Program Design Meeting Questions is the process of creating, creating, screening, and maintaining software application. It is a methodical and self-displined technique to software development that aims to create top quality, trusted, and maintainable software. Software application designers produce software solutions for end customers by using design principles and their understanding of programming languages.
It is an attributes of software that describes its capacity to execute what it was designed to do precisely and consistently gradually. It describes the level to which the software can be utilized with ease. The quantity of initiative or time required to find out how to use the software program.
It describes how basic it is to improve and modify the software. It describes just how quickly a software application system can be customized to add attribute, enhance speed, or repair work faults. It describes how well the software application can work with different platforms or situations without making major adjustments.
For more information please refer to the adhering to short article Attributes of Software application. The software program is used thoroughly in a number of domains consisting of hospitals, banks, institutions, protection, money, stock exchange, and so on. It can be categorized into various types: For even more information please refer to the adhering to post Classifications of Software program.
It is defined by a structured, sequential method to task monitoring and software application development. It is good to utilize this version when the modern technology is well comprehended.
Beta testing typically makes use of black-box screening. Beta testing is carried out at the end-user, the of the product.
Reliability, safety, and effectiveness are checked during beta testing. Alpha screening makes certain the quality of the item before forwarding it to beta screening. Beta screening also concentrates on the quality of the item however collects the customer's time-long input on the product and ensures that the item awaits real-time users.
Table of Contents
Latest Posts
The Best Courses For Full-stack Developer Interview Preparation
The 6-Second Trick For 365 Data Science: Learn Data Science With Our Online Courses
The 4-Minute Rule for Best Udemy Data Science Courses 2025: My Top Findings
More
Latest Posts
The Best Courses For Full-stack Developer Interview Preparation
The 6-Second Trick For 365 Data Science: Learn Data Science With Our Online Courses
The 4-Minute Rule for Best Udemy Data Science Courses 2025: My Top Findings